I started using Ubuntu in my new Asus VivoBook S14 X430UA laptop. But it
is very disappointing that the keyboard light cannot be controlled using
the dedicated switch (fn + f7). Similarly fn + f8 also not working,
which is for screen toggling.

echo 3 | sudo tee /sys/class/leds/asus::kbd_backlight/brightness

command to switch on the keyboard light is working fine. Is there any
solution for this issue?
